- Data Hackers Newsletter
- Posts
- Model Context Protocol (MCP): o novo padrão open-source da Anthropic para conectar IAs a dados reais
Model Context Protocol (MCP): o novo padrão open-source da Anthropic para conectar IAs a dados reais
Conheça o modelo que, ao permitir a conexão entre IA e dados reais de forma fácil, promete combater o problema da fragmentação de dados
A Anthropic anunciou recentemente o lançamento do Model Context Protocol (MCP), um protocolo aberto e universal que promete revolucionar a forma como assistentes de IA se conectam a fontes de dados. Esta iniciativa open-source tem como objetivo principal resolver um dos maiores desafios enfrentados por modelos de linguagem avançados: o acesso fragmentado e isolado a informações relevantes.
O desafio da fragmentação de dados em sistemas de IA
Apesar dos avanços impressionantes em capacidades de raciocínio e qualidade dos modelos de IA, existe um problema fundamental que limita seu potencial: o isolamento dos dados. Mesmo os modelos mais sofisticados enfrentam barreiras quando precisam acessar informações distribuídas em repositórios de conteúdo, ferramentas corporativas e ambientes de desenvolvimento.
Cada nova fonte de dados tradicionalmente exige uma implementação customizada própria, tornando a criação de sistemas verdadeiramente conectados uma tarefa complexa e difícil de escalar. É exatamente esse gargalo que o MCP se propõe a eliminar.
Como funciona o Model Context Protocol
O MCP oferece um padrão universal e aberto para conectar sistemas de IA com fontes de dados, substituindo integrações fragmentadas por um único protocolo unificado. A arquitetura é desenhada para ser simples e eficiente: desenvolvedores podem expor seus dados através de MCP servers ou construir aplicações de IA (MCP clients) que se conectam a esses servidores.
Componentes principais do MCP
A Anthropic está disponibilizando três componentes essenciais para desenvolvedores:
Especificações e SDKs do Model Context Protocol: Disponíveis no repositório oficial, permitindo que desenvolvedores implementem o protocolo em suas próprias aplicações
Suporte a servidores MCP locais no Claude Desktop: Os aplicativos desktop do Claude agora oferecem suporte nativo para conexão com servidores MCP
Repositório open-source de servidores MCP: Uma coleção de implementações pré-construídas para sistemas corporativos populares como Google Drive, Slack, GitHub, Git, Postgres e Puppeteer
Claude 3.5 Sonnet e a criação rápida de servidores MCP
Uma característica notável é a capacidade do Claude 3.5 Sonnet em construir rapidamente implementações de servidores MCP. Isso permite que organizações e desenvolvedores individuais conectem seus datasets mais importantes com diversas ferramentas de IA de forma ágil e eficiente.
Casos de uso e adoção inicial
Empresas e plataformas de desenvolvimento já estão explorando as possibilidades do MCP:
Empresas pioneiras
Block: A empresa vê o protocolo como uma ponte fundamental que conecta IA a aplicações do mundo real, garantindo que a inovação seja acessível, transparente e baseada em colaboração.
Apollo: Integrou o MCP em seus sistemas para melhorar o acesso contextual a dados.
Ferramentas de desenvolvimento
Empresas como Zed, Replit, Codeium e Sourcegraph estão trabalhando com o MCP para aprimorar suas plataformas. O protocolo permite que agentes de IA recuperem informações mais relevantes, compreendam melhor o contexto de tarefas de codificação e produzam código mais funcional e refinado com menos tentativas.
Benefícios do Model Context Protocol para desenvolvedores
Benefício | Descrição |
|---|---|
Padrão universal | Elimina a necessidade de manter conectores separados para cada fonte de dados |
Simplicidade | Arquitetura direta que facilita a implementação |
Contexto persistente | Sistemas de IA mantêm contexto ao navegar entre diferentes ferramentas e datasets |
Open-source | Comunidade pode contribuir e melhorar o protocolo |
Escalabilidade | Substitui integrações fragmentadas por uma arquitetura sustentável |
Como começar a usar o MCP
Desenvolvedores podem começar a construir e testar conectores MCP imediatamente. Todos os planos do Claude.ai oferecem suporte para conectar servidores MCP ao aplicativo Claude Desktop.
Para desenvolvedores individuais
Instale servidores MCP pré-construídos através do aplicativo Claude Desktop
Siga o guia de início rápido para construir seu primeiro servidor MCP
Contribua para os repositórios open-source de conectores e implementações
Para clientes corporativos (Claude for Work)
Clientes do Claude for Work podem começar a testar servidores MCP localmente, conectando o Claude a sistemas internos e datasets corporativos. Em breve, a Anthropic disponibilizará toolkits de desenvolvimento para implementar servidores MCP de produção remotos que podem servir toda a organização.
O futuro do MCP como projeto comunitário
A Anthropic está comprometida em desenvolver o MCP como um projeto open-source colaborativo e em construir um ecossistema robusto ao redor do protocolo. A empresa convida desenvolvedores de ferramentas de IA, empresas que buscam aproveitar dados existentes e early adopters a participarem da construção do futuro de sistemas de IA conscientes de contexto.
Perguntas frequentes sobre o MCP
O que diferencia o MCP de outras soluções de integração?
O MCP oferece um padrão universal e aberto, eliminando a necessidade de múltiplas integrações customizadas. Ao contrário de soluções proprietárias, é open-source e projetado para ser agnóstico em relação a fornecedores.
Quais sistemas já possuem suporte nativo ao MCP?
Atualmente, existem servidores pré-construídos para Google Drive, Slack, GitHub, Git, Postgres e Puppeteer, entre outros. A comunidade está continuamente adicionando novos conectores.
É necessário ser cliente corporativo para usar o MCP?
Não. Todos os planos do Claude.ai, incluindo planos individuais, oferecem suporte para conexão com servidores MCP através do aplicativo desktop.
Como o MCP afeta a segurança dos dados?
O MCP foi projetado com segurança em mente, oferecendo conexões bidirecionais seguras entre fontes de dados e ferramentas de IA. As implementações podem incluir controles de acesso e autenticação conforme necessário.
Conclusão
O Model Context Protocol representa um passo significativo na evolução de sistemas de IA, abordando um dos principais obstáculos para a adoção em larga escala: o acesso fragmentado a dados. Ao oferecer um padrão aberto e universal, a Anthropic está facilitando a criação de assistentes de IA verdadeiramente conectados e conscientes do contexto.
Com o apoio inicial de empresas estabelecidas e ferramentas de desenvolvimento populares, o MCP tem potencial para se tornar o padrão da indústria para integração de IA com fontes de dados. Para a comunidade de desenvolvedores brasileira, esta é uma oportunidade única de participar desde o início de um protocolo que pode definir como trabalhamos com IA nos próximos anos.
Os recursos estão disponíveis gratuitamente, e a comunidade já está ativa construindo novos conectores e explorando casos de uso inovadores. Se você trabalha com IA ou desenvolvimento de software, vale a pena explorar o que o MCP pode fazer pela sua organização.